A bronze Secretariat portraying the champion in all his glory! Once again, Penny Chenery commissioned acclaimed sculptor Kitty Cantrell and award winning painter Caroline Boydston to produce this landmark piece. With over 70 years of experience between them, Ms. Cantrell is nationally recognized for her meticulous detailed work that captures the essence and movement of her subjects while Ms. Boydston is renowned for her unique painting and patina techniques. Pieces of their work reside throughout the country including the lobbies of the Central Intelligence Agency and the Air Force Academy. Their work in the equine form is as merited as it is valuable with their highly coveted collaborations in great demand throughout the art community. Mrs. Chenery would allow only the finest and most disciplined portrayal of Secretariat to serve for this officially licensed product and it shows in this magnificent piece. Boydston and Cantrell Bronze Sculpture
Secretariat

The bronze sculpture sits on a base adorned with two brass plaques. The front plaque contains the general information of Secretariat and his pedigree while the reverse plaque is individually engraved with the specific edition number. Weighing nearly 13 pounds, the substantial sculpture matches the significance of its subject.
